nihongo|Kanda|苅田町|Kanda-machi is a town located in Miyako District, Fukuoka, Japan.

As of 2003, the town has an estimated population of 35,407 and a density of 762.10 persons per km². The total area is 46.46 km².

Nishinippon Institute of Technology is located in the town.

Industry

The Nissan Motor Kyushu factory started operation in Kanda in 1975.
